Fayette County is 0-5 against LaGrange since September of 2022 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Tuesday. The Fayette County Tigers will face off against the LaGrange Grangers at 6:35 p.m.
Fayette County's hitters might be in the hot seat on Tuesday considering what happened against Mary Persons on Thursday. They came up short against the Bulldogs, falling 14-0. The Tigers' loss continues a trend for the squad, making it three in a row.
Meanwhile, LaGrange didn't have done well against Heard County recently (they were 1-7 in their previous eight mat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Monday. LaGrange walked away with a 6-2 win over Heard County. The victory was a breath of fresh air for the Grangers as it put an end to their three-game losing streak.
Fayette County's defeat dropped their record down to 1-8. As for LaGrange, their record is now 10-6.
Fayette County suffered a grim 14-7 defeat to LaGrange in their previous matchup back in August. Can Fayette County av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
